A Warning for Parents
Article by Lauri McNair, MS
"...And do not let your people practice fortune-telling, or use sorcery, or interpret omens, or engage in witchcraft or cast spells, or function as mediums or psychics, or call forth the spirits of the dead."
--Deuteronomy 18:10-11(NLT)
Many of today's youth are curious about the occult and witchcraft. Most of the "kid-friendly" movies and TV shows include some form of magic and witchcraft. We as parents and caregivers must be very deliberate and vigilant in what we allow our children to listen to and watch, as the eyes and ears are gateways to the soul. The enemy wants access to our children, and he will pursue them at a very young age. Once he has access, he knows he can create strongholds and bring about bondage.
My husband, who is a high school educator, recently shared with me a disturbing new game that is extremely popular on YouTube and is being circulated throughout schools. It is called the Charlie Challenge Pencil game. This is an occult game in which incantations are used to evoke demonic activity evidenced by pencils moving. Kids think it's funny.
Some may mock or scoff at this warning thinking, "it's just a game" or "kids will be kids", however the Bible is very clear that believers are to have no involvement in such activities. There are reasons God gives warnings against participating in the occult. The primary reason is it is an abomination to him. Also, participating in these activities open doors to the unseen realm of the demonic which can evoke feelings of fear, anxiety, depression, anger and rage, as well as a myriad of perversions--to name but a few.
I remember working with a teenage girl who was extremely oppositional and defiant. She was also truant, disrespectful, and rebellious. Her mother was at her wits end. One of her chief complaints was that all her daughter wanted to do was watch the movie, The Craft. She shared that there had been a drastic change in her daughter's behavior since watching that movie. A stronghold had been built and this young teen was in bondage.
Parents, take time to check in with your kids. Ask questions. Find out what is "trending now" in their lives. Talk with other parents. Be informed. The word of God cautions us to not be ignorant of Satan's devices. The more knowledge and understanding we have, the better we are able to guard and protect our children.
